This property, located at 33 Harling Street, BB12 6JG in Burnley, is a mid-terrace house built between 1900-1929. The house measures 86 square meters and features fully double-glazed windows. It has a current energy rating of D and a potential energy efficiency of 83. The property has mains gas for heating and hot water, with a boiler and radiators. It also has a pitched roof with 150mm loft insulation. The property's running costs are £955 per year.
